Asbestos has been widely used in thousands of American products during the 20th century however regulations were not implemented on asbestos until the 1970s It has been banned in 60 countries but not the United States and exposure to the fibers is the leading cause of work related deaths in the world

·While mining for asbestos ended in 2002 in the US many miners have been exposed since then because some minerals for example talc and vermiculite are contaminated with asbestos

·Similarly their infrastructure would be built over the asbestos and foundation works would involve digging up asbestos Similarly their mine dam would involve digging up asbestos Workers on the site would be exposed to the asbestos dust and the prevailing winds would cause that asbestos dust to fall onto Beaconsfield and other settled areas
